国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

Windows系統(tǒng)下動態(tài)磁盤卷的分析與研究

2017-07-10 09:33曹紀磊
電腦知識與技術(shù) 2017年14期
關(guān)鍵詞:磁盤扇區(qū)分區(qū)

曹紀磊

摘要:對于大多數(shù)用戶來說,已經(jīng)知道在MBR磁盤分區(qū)結(jié)構(gòu)中,系統(tǒng)通過分區(qū)表項對分區(qū)進項管理,因為分區(qū)表項中管理分區(qū)大小的參數(shù)是有四個字節(jié)組成的,所以能夠管理的分區(qū)最大為2048GB,也就是2TB。隨著硬盤容量的不斷增大,以及用戶對存儲空間需求的不斷最大,2TB的分區(qū)已經(jīng)不能滿足用戶的需求,特別是無法滿足大型企業(yè)用戶的需求。那么如何解決這個矛盾呢,微軟提供的動態(tài)磁盤分區(qū)就很好地解決了這個問題。該文就動態(tài)磁盤卷的種類、創(chuàng)建方法以及動態(tài)磁盤的LDM結(jié)構(gòu)進行了分析與研究。

關(guān)鍵詞:動態(tài)磁盤;分區(qū);卷

中圖分類號:TP311 文獻標識碼:A 文章編號:1009-3044(2017)14-0198-02

1動態(tài)磁盤卷由來

動態(tài)磁盤與MBR磁盤相比,在磁盤的管理和使用特性上更加機動靈活,特別是在數(shù)據(jù)的容錯、高速度的讀寫操作以及卷的大小修改上更加易于實現(xiàn),這些都是微軟公司針對MBR磁盤不能實現(xiàn)的情況下在Windows2000系統(tǒng)后新增加的特性。

一塊MBR磁盤只能包含4個分區(qū),它們是最多3個主磁盤分區(qū)和1個擴展分區(qū),擴展分區(qū)可能包含多個邏輯驅(qū)動器。而動態(tài)磁盤可以在每個磁盤組內(nèi)創(chuàng)建多個2000個動態(tài)卷,盡管微軟推薦值為每磁盤32個或更少。

在MBR磁盤中,分區(qū)是不可跨越磁盤的。但是,我們可以通過一定方式將磁盤中空余的磁盤空間鏈接在一塊,從而來擴大卷的空間。

MBR磁盤的讀/寫速度由硬件決定,很難通過硬盤自身提升讀/寫效率。但動態(tài)磁盤可以通過創(chuàng)建帶區(qū)卷來同時對多塊磁盤進行讀/寫,顯著提升磁盤效率。

MBR磁盤不可容錯,如果沒有及時備份而遭遇磁盤失敗會有極大的損失動態(tài)磁盤上可以創(chuàng)建鏡像卷,所有內(nèi)容自動實時備份到鏡像磁盤中,及時遭到磁盤失敗也不必擔心數(shù)據(jù)損失。

2動態(tài)磁盤卷的種類及創(chuàng)建方法

一般情況下,都把磁盤作為MBR磁盤使用,為了使用動態(tài)磁盤卷,首先必須將其轉(zhuǎn)換為動態(tài)磁盤。依照下面步驟打開“磁盤管理”:控制面板一管理工具一計算機管理一磁盤管理,這時就可以通過右鍵菜單將選擇磁盤轉(zhuǎn)換為動態(tài)磁盤。

將MBR磁盤轉(zhuǎn)換為動態(tài)磁盤后面對磁盤就是用“卷”的形式進行管理了,而不是MBR磁盤下的“分區(qū)”,在“磁盤2”的區(qū)域點擊鼠標右鍵,顯示“新建卷”,而不是“新建分區(qū)”。

基于動態(tài)磁盤的卷有五種如圖1所示,它們分別是:

1)簡單卷:構(gòu)成單個物理磁盤空間的卷,它可以由磁盤上的單個區(qū)域或同一磁盤上連接在一起的多個區(qū)域組成,可以在同一磁盤內(nèi)擴展簡單卷。

2)跨區(qū)卷:簡單卷也可以擴展到其他的物理磁盤,這樣由多個物理磁盤的空間組成的卷就稱為跨區(qū)卷。簡單卷和跨區(qū)卷都不屬于RAID范疇。

3)帶區(qū)卷:以帶區(qū)形式在連個后多個物理磁盤上存儲數(shù)據(jù)的卷帶區(qū)卷上的數(shù)據(jù)被交替、平均(以帶區(qū)形式)地分配給這些磁盤。

4)鏡像卷:在兩個物理磁盤上復制數(shù)據(jù)的容錯卷。它通過使用卷的副本(鏡像)復制該卷中的信息來提供數(shù)據(jù)冗余,鏡像總位于另一個磁盤上,如果其中一個物理磁盤出現(xiàn)故障,則該故障磁盤上的數(shù)據(jù)將不可用嗎,但是系統(tǒng)可以使用未受影響的磁盤繼續(xù)操作。

5)RAID-5卷:具有數(shù)據(jù)和奇偶校驗的容錯卷,數(shù)據(jù)分布于三個或更多的物理磁盤,奇偶校驗用于在陣列失效后重建數(shù)據(jù)。如果物理磁盤的某一部分失敗,可以用以下的數(shù)據(jù)和奇偶校驗信息重新創(chuàng)建磁盤上失敗的那一部分上的數(shù)據(jù)。

3動態(tài)磁盤LDM結(jié)構(gòu)原理

3.1動態(tài)磁盤的結(jié)構(gòu)布局

動態(tài)磁盤的相關(guān)設(shè)置信息所存放的信息不是存在不方便修改的地方,而是放在了磁盤中,并且同時也備份到了另外一些動態(tài)磁盤上,這樣設(shè)置的目的也是為了更靈活、快捷的實現(xiàn)不同設(shè)備之間的動態(tài)磁盤的拷貝。

LDM也實現(xiàn)了一個MS-DOS的分區(qū)表,這是為了繼承一些在Windows2000/XP下運行的磁盤管理工具,或是在雙引導環(huán)境中讓其他系統(tǒng)不至于認為動態(tài)盤還沒有被分區(qū)。

另一個LDM創(chuàng)建MS-DOS分區(qū)表的原因是為了讓Win-dows2000/XP引導程序能夠找到系統(tǒng)卷和引導卷,即使它們在動態(tài)盤上(例如,Ntldr就不知道LDM分區(qū)的存在)如果一個盤中包括系統(tǒng)卷和引導卷,MS-DOS風格分區(qū)類型。保存在MS-DOS分區(qū)中的區(qū)域就是LDM創(chuàng)建raunchv分區(qū)的地方。一個LDM創(chuàng)建MS-DOS分區(qū)表的原因是為了讓Windows2000/XP引導程序能夠找到系統(tǒng)卷和引導卷,即使它們在動態(tài)盤上(例如,Ntldr就不知道LDM分區(qū)的存在)如果一個盤中包括系統(tǒng)卷和引導卷,MS-DOS風格分區(qū)類型。保存在MS-DOS分區(qū)中的區(qū)域就是LDM創(chuàng)建raunchv分區(qū)的地方。

動態(tài)磁盤的結(jié)構(gòu)布局如圖2所示。從圖中可以看出,動態(tài)盤由三部分結(jié)構(gòu)組成:

1)MBR區(qū)。動態(tài)磁盤的第一個扇區(qū)與MBR磁盤一樣,是一個MBR,MBR的分區(qū)表中有一項MS-DOS類型的分區(qū)表項。

2)LDM軟分區(qū)區(qū)域。這一部分用來給動態(tài)磁盤劃分軟分區(qū)。

3)LDM數(shù)據(jù)庫區(qū)域。LDM數(shù)據(jù)庫占用動態(tài)磁盤最后1MB的空間,其中含有私有頭的兩個備份,并且用特定的數(shù)據(jù)結(jié)構(gòu)記錄著動態(tài)磁盤的結(jié)構(gòu)信息。

3.2動態(tài)磁盤的LDM數(shù)據(jù)庫

首先強調(diào)一點,動態(tài)磁盤的LDM數(shù)據(jù)庫中數(shù)據(jù)存儲的字節(jié)序都是Big-Endian。LDM數(shù)據(jù)庫占用動態(tài)磁盤最后IMB空間,也就是2048個扇區(qū)的大小。下面以LDM數(shù)據(jù)庫的起始扇區(qū)為0扇區(qū),來描述LDM數(shù)據(jù)庫的結(jié)構(gòu)。

1)目錄表(TOCBLOCK)的結(jié)構(gòu)

LDM數(shù)據(jù)庫目錄表共有16個扇區(qū)大小,一般只用到前兩個扇區(qū),這兩個目錄表分別在LDM數(shù)據(jù)庫的2045和2046扇區(qū)有一個備份。

2)數(shù)據(jù)庫配置信息(VMDB)的結(jié)構(gòu)

數(shù)據(jù)庫配置信息(VNDB)起始于LDM的17號扇區(qū),占用1個扇區(qū),其中存放關(guān)于動態(tài)磁盤的總體信息。

3)數(shù)據(jù)庫配置記錄(VBLK)的結(jié)構(gòu)

數(shù)據(jù)庫配置記錄(VBLK)是128字節(jié)定長記錄,每一個VBLK項描述一個磁盤組、磁盤、分區(qū)、組件或卷。因為動態(tài)磁盤組,所以每一個VBLK項可以是如下四種類型之一:磁盤、分區(qū)、組件、卷。

LDM把每一個VBLK項與內(nèi)部對此昂的標識符聯(lián)系到一起。最低的級別,分區(qū)項描述軟分區(qū),它是一個盤上的連續(xù)項代表一個磁盤組中的動態(tài)盤,包括磁盤的GUID。組件項像一條鏈子把一個或多個分區(qū)項和與分區(qū)相連的卷項聯(lián)系起來。卷項存放這個卷的CUID、卷的大小和狀態(tài)、驅(qū)動器的名字。比一個數(shù)據(jù)庫記錄大的磁盤項占用多個記錄的空間,分區(qū)項、組件項和卷項很少占用多個記錄的空間。最低的級別,分區(qū)項描述軟分區(qū),它是一個盤上的連續(xù)項代表一個磁盤組中的動態(tài)盤,包括磁盤的GUID。組件項像一條鏈子把一個或多個分區(qū)項和與分區(qū)相連的卷項聯(lián)系起來。卷項存放這個卷的CUID、卷的大小和狀態(tài)、驅(qū)動器的名字。比一個數(shù)據(jù)庫記錄大的磁盤項占用多個記錄的空間,分區(qū)項、組件項和卷項很少占用多個記錄的空間。

在動態(tài)磁盤內(nèi)部,每一磁盤、分區(qū)、組件和卷都被賦予一個唯一的名稱。磁盤組是由Dg0和計算機的名字一起組成,例如LiuWeiDg0,意味著計算機的名字是LiuWei。磁盤名稱為DisKl、DisK2等。磁盤1的分區(qū)命名為DisKl-01 DisKl-02等。條帶卷命名為Strpel Strpe2等。RAID卷命名為Raid1、Raid2等。簡單卷、跨區(qū)卷和鏡像卷命名為Volumel Volume2等。卷的組件命名為Stripel-01 tripe2-02、Strpel-01、Strpe2-02、Volumel-01、Volumel-02等。當對象刪除時,新對象命名時使用第一個可以使用的低數(shù)值得名稱。

4總結(jié)

對于邏輯類數(shù)據(jù)恢復技術(shù)的學習,最重要的就是對各種系統(tǒng)下的分區(qū)結(jié)構(gòu)及文件系統(tǒng)結(jié)構(gòu)的學習。Windows系統(tǒng)它能夠支持的分區(qū)結(jié)構(gòu)包括MBR磁盤分區(qū)、動態(tài)磁盤分區(qū)及GPT磁盤分區(qū);它能夠支持的文件系統(tǒng)結(jié)構(gòu)包括FAT12、FAT16、FAT32、NTFS和EXFAT。本文針對動態(tài)磁盤分區(qū)的結(jié)構(gòu)進行了深入的解析,為我們做好Windows系統(tǒng)下的數(shù)據(jù)恢復奠定了很好的基礎(chǔ)。

猜你喜歡
磁盤扇區(qū)分區(qū)
上海實施“分區(qū)封控”
修改磁盤屬性
浪莎 分區(qū)而治
U盤故障排除經(jīng)驗談
磁盤組群組及iSCSI Target設(shè)置
創(chuàng)建VSAN群集
基于貝葉斯估計的短時空域扇區(qū)交通流量預測
重建分區(qū)表與FAT32_DBR研究與實現(xiàn)
基于SAGA聚類分析的無功電壓控制分區(qū)
基于多種群遺傳改進FCM的無功/電壓控制分區(qū)